Partager via


Register-AzRecoveryServicesBackupContainer

L’applet de commande Register-AzRecoveryServicesBackupContainer inscrit une machine virtuelle Azure pour AzureWorkloads avec un workloadType spécifique.

Syntaxe

Register-AzRecoveryServicesBackupContainer
        [-ResourceId] <String>
        [-BackupManagementType] <BackupManagementType>
        [-WorkloadType] <WorkloadType>
        [-Force]
        [-VaultId <String>]
        [-DefaultProfile <IAzureContextContainer>]
        [-WhatIf]
        [-Confirm]
        [<CommonParameters>]
Register-AzRecoveryServicesBackupContainer
        [-Container] <ContainerBase>
        [-BackupManagementType] <BackupManagementType>
        [-WorkloadType] <WorkloadType>
        [-Force]
        [-VaultId <String>]
        [-DefaultProfile <IAzureContextContainer>]
        [-WhatIf]
        [-Confirm]
        [<CommonParameters>]

Description

Cette commande permet Sauvegarde Azure de convertir la ressource en conteneur de sauvegarde qui est ensuite inscrit dans le coffre Recovery Services donné. Le service Sauvegarde Azure peut ensuite découvrir les charges de travail du type de charge de travail donné dans ce conteneur à protéger ultérieurement.

Exemples

Exemple 1 Inscrire un conteneur de sauvegarde

Register-AzRecoveryServicesBackupContainer -ResourceId <AzureVMID> -VaultId <vaultID> -WorkloadType MSSQL -BackupManagementType AzureWorkload

L’applet de commande inscrit une machine virtuelle Azure en tant que conteneur pour la charge de travail MSSQL.

Exemple 2 Réinscrire un conteneur de sauvegarde

$vault = Get-AzRecoveryServicesVault -ResourceGroupName "rgName"  -Name "vaultName"
$container = Get-AzRecoveryServicesBackupContainer -ContainerType AzureVMAppContainer -VaultId $vault.ID 
Register-AzRecoveryServicesBackupContainer -Container $container[-1] -BackupManagementType AzureWorkload -WorkloadType MSSQL -VaultId $vault.ID

La première commande récupère le coffre Recovery Services. La deuxième commande récupère tous les conteneurs de sauvegarde inscrits auprès du coffre Recovery Services. La troisième commande déclenche une opération de réinscription pour le conteneur $container[-1], afin de réinscrire un conteneur déjà inscrit que nous transmettons -Container parameter.

Paramètres

-BackupManagementType

Classe de ressources protégées. Actuellement, la valeur prise en charge pour cette applet de commande est AzureWorkload

Type:BackupManagementType
Valeurs acceptées:AzureWorkload
Position:1
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-Confirm

Vous demande une confirmation avant d’exécuter la commande cmdlet.

Type:SwitchParameter
Alias:cf
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-Container

Conteneur où réside l’élément

Type:ContainerBase
Position:0
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:True
Accepter les caractères génériques:False

-DefaultProfile

Informations d’identification, compte, locataire et abonnement utilisés pour la communication avec Azure.

Type:IAzureContextContainer
Alias:AzContext, AzureRmContext, AzureCredential
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-Force

Forcer le conteneur d’inscriptions (empêche la boîte de dialogue de confirmation). Ce paramètre est facultatif.

Type:SwitchParameter
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-ResourceId

ID de la ressource Azure dont l’élément représentatif doit être vérifié s’il est déjà protégé par un coffre RecoveryServices dans l’abonnement.

Type:String
Position:0
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-VaultId

ID ARM du coffre Recovery Services.

Type:String
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:True
Accepter les caractères génériques:False

-WhatIf

Montre ce qui se passe en cas d’exécution de la commande cmdlet.

Type:SwitchParameter
Alias:wi
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-WorkloadType

Type de charge de travail de la ressource. La valeur prise en charge actuelle est AzureVM, WindowsServer, AzureFiles, MSSQL

Type:WorkloadType
Valeurs acceptées:AzureVM, AzureSQLDatabase, AzureFiles, MSSQL
Position:2
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

Entrées

String

Sorties

ContainerBase